The traditional method of artificially calculating artillery firing elements using shots, drawing boards, coordinate paper and slide rule, is not only cumbersome and slow but also inaccurate and can easily create human error. Therefore, there is a need for a device that can quickly and accurately determine firing elements. With the advent of self-propelled anti-aircraft guns, this demand has become even more pressing. With the advent of small digital computers, it is possible to develop a new generation of artillery firing computers to greatly enhance the combat effectiveness of the highly mobile forces
